  • The giant squid nebula: Difficult to capture, this mysterious, squid-shaped interstellar cloud spans nearly three full moons in planet Earth's sky. Discovered in 2011 by French astro-imager Nicolas Outters, the Squid Nebula's bipolar shape is distinguished here by the telltale blue emission from doubly ionized oxygen atoms. Though apparently surrounded by the reddish hydrogen emission region Sh2-129, the true distance and nature of the Squid Nebula have been difficult to determine. Still, one investigation suggests Ou4 really does lie within Sh2-129 some 2,300 light-years away. Consistent with that scenario, the cosmic squid would represent a spectacular outflow of material driven by a triple system of hot, massive stars, cataloged as HR8119, seen near the center of the nebula. If so, this truly giant squid nebula would physically be over 50 light-years across.

  • For a long time, scientists believed the human nose could only detect about 10,000 different smells. But recent research has shattered that idea, we now know the human nose can distinguish over a trillion unique scents! This incredible ability comes from the hundreds of olfactory receptors inside your nose, each designed to pick up specific molecules in the air. When these receptors work together in different combinations, they create a vast “smell library” in your brain and can store them for later recognition.

  • 55 Cancri e is an exoplanet located about 40 light-years from Earth in the constellation Cancer. It's roughly twice the size of Earth but orbits its star extremely closely so close that a year there lasts just 18 hours. What makes it truly fascinating is that its composition is believed to be very different from Earth's. Based on its mass and size, astronomers theorize that it could have a carbon-rich interior. Under immense pressure, this carbon may have crystallized into diamond, making it a planet potentially covered in diamonds beneath its surface.

  • In some animals like turtles, crocodiles, and lizards, the temperature of the egg during development decides the gender process called Temperature-Dependent Sex Determination (TSD). For example, in many turtles, cooler temperatures produce males, while warmer ones produce females.   • Human bioluminescence, the faint, invisible light emitted by the human body due to metabolic processes. This light, also known as biophotons or ultra-weak photon emission, is far too weak for the human eye to perceive. It's a result of chemical reactions within cells, particularly those involving free radicals and fluorophores, and is thought to be a byproduct of cellular respiration

  • European eels have a fascinating and unique breeding cycle involving a long migration to the Sargasso Sea, where they spawn and die. The larvae, known as leptocephali, drift with ocean currents back towards Europe, transforming into glass eels and eventually yellow eels in freshwater habitats. They then undergo a final transformation into silver eels before their return journey to the Sargasso Sea to spawn.

  • Octopuses are fascinating marine creatures with a truly unique circulatory system they have three hearts! Two of these hearts are responsible for pumping blood to the gills, where oxygen is absorbed, while the third heart pumps the oxygenated blood to the rest of the body. Interestingly, when an octopus swims, the main heart that circulates blood through the body temporarily stops beating. This is one reason octopuses prefer crawling to swimming, it's less exhausting for them. Their blood is also blue due to a copper-rich molecule called hemocyanin, which helps them survive in cold, low-oxygen environments
